About Ochsner LSU Health

Ochsner LSU Health is a leading academic health system in Shreveport, Louisiana, United States, formed through a groundbreaking partnership in 2018 between Ochsner Health and LSU Health Shreveport. This collaboration has created a powerhouse for medical education, patient care, and research, serving the northern Louisiana region with state-of-the-art facilities. The institution's history traces back to LSU's medical school roots in the 1960s, evolving into a comprehensive health sciences center that now integrates Ochsner's clinical expertise. Key achievements include pioneering advancements in telemedicine, cancer research, and cardiovascular care, with a mission to improve health outcomes through innovation, education, and community service. Ochsner LSU Health operates multiple campuses, including the main academic medical center in Shreveport and affiliated clinics across the region. Research and Innovation at Ochsner LSU Health

Research at Ochsner LSU Health focuses on cancer, cardiovascular diseases, and telemedicine, with major centers like the Feist-Weiller Cancer Center. 2025 trends include AI in diagnostics and collaborations with NIH. 🔬 Explore Research Jobs.

Funding exceeds $50 million annually, supporting innovative projects.
